Serbia’s Vojvodina invests 7.3 mln euro in water purification plant

March 26 (SeeNews) - Serbia’s autonomous province of Vojvodina said it has signed a deal for the construction of a water purification plant in the northern town of Vrdnik, in a project costing 850 million dinars ($7.9 million/7.3 million euro).

“This is a very important investment because it will contribute to the protection of water and the preservation of the environment, the development of the economy, and improvement of the tourist offer of this region,” said head of the local government, Igor Moronic, in a press release last week.

Mirovic said that the municipality of Irig has great potential in wine and spa tourism, with the possibility to expand this in the coming years, and the construction of the Fruskogorski Corridor road will contribute to this.

The 606 million euro ($657.1 million) Fruskogorski Corridor road project, which represents an upgrade to the Novi Sad-Ruma section of Serbia's IB-21 state road, will be carried out by China Road and Bridge Corporation (CRBC).

$ = 0.9223 euro
